Output 18be5a896a3b0377c4c26a5320e261a5ade8906f915ef577d0a97d7d4f0bddbf:0

value
1081378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15039ad59e70e45726ebf39f86c0b03229e5bc2b OP_EQUAL
address
33c8S3FY98wm7xvNw1mxD8CKktW6zcHx6g
transaction
18be5a896a3b0377c4c26a5320e261a5ade8906f915ef577d0a97d7d4f0bddbf
spent
true